The GrUSP, the Italian PHP user group, organises the 8th phpDay, a conference dedicated to PHP for the enterprise.
09:45 |
Developing PHP in the Cloud
Keynote by Zeev Suraski Developing PHP in the Cloud |
11:00 |
What they didn't tell you about object-oriented programming in PHP
Talk by Giorgio Sironi in track 1 What they didn't tell you about object-oriented programming in PHP |
Streams: An In-Depth Look
Talk by Davey Shafik in track 2 Streams: An In-Depth Look |
|
Test Driven Development with Symfony 2
Workshop by Jacopo Romei in track 3 Test Driven Development with Symfony 2 |
|
12:00 |
Mobile Drupal
Talk by Stefano Mainardi, Paolo Mainardi in track 1 Mobile Drupal |
Mastering PHP Data Structure 102
Talk by Patrick Allaert in track 2 Mastering PHP Data Structure 102 |
|
14:30 |
Scalable architectures: Taming the Twitter Firehose
Talk by Lorenzo Alberton in track 1 Scalable architectures: Taming the Twitter Firehose |
PHAR, the PHP .exe format
Talk by Helgi Þormar Þorbjörnsson in track 2 PHAR, the PHP .exe format |
|
Step By Step: Making a website fly with Assetic, Varnish and ESI
Talk by David Buchmann in track 3 Step By Step: Making a website fly with Assetic, Varnish and ESI |
|
15:30 |
BDD : Buzzword driven development. Build the next cool app (for fun and for… fun)
Talk by Michele Orselli, cirpo in track 1 BDD : Buzzword driven development. Build the next cool app (for fun and for… fun) |
PHP Extensions, why and what?
Talk by Derick Rethans in track 2 PHP Extensions, why and what? |
|
Security at scale: Web application security in a continuous deployment environment
Talk by Zane Lackey in track 3 Security at scale: Web application security in a continuous deployment environment |
|
17:00 |
Lazy Evaluation: stop wasting memory and time
Talk by Juozas in track 1 Lazy Evaluation: stop wasting memory and time |
Io cache, tu database
Talk by Daniel Londero in track 3 Io cache, tu database |
|
17:30 |
Get'em in shape: let customers appreciate the agile workflow
Talk by Stefano "Steve" Maraspin in track 1 Get'em in shape: let customers appreciate the agile workflow |
PHPCR - PHP Content Repository Specification
Talk by Lukas Kahwe Smith in track 2 PHPCR - PHP Content Repository Specification |
|
Symfony2 and MongoDB
Talk by Pablo Godel in track 3 Symfony2 and MongoDB |
|
22:00 |
Symfony CMF
Talk by Jacopo Romei in track 2 Symfony CMF |
09:45 |
PHP in 2012
Keynote by Rasmus Lerdorf PHP in 2012 |
11:00 |
A quick start on Zend Framework 2
Talk by Enrico Zimuel in track 1 A quick start on Zend Framework 2 |
Best Practice in API Design
Talk by Lorna Mitchell in track 2 Best Practice in API Design |
|
Create your own PHP extension, step by step
Workshop by Derick Rethans, Rasmus Lerdorf, Patrick Allaert in track 3 Create your own PHP extension, step by step |
|
12:00 |
A Practical Look At Symfony2
Talk by Stefan Koopmanschap in track 1 A Practical Look At Symfony2 |
Scaling Communication with Continuous Integration
Talk by Laura Beth Denker in track 2 Scaling Communication with Continuous Integration |
|
14:30 |
Silex - The Symfony2 microframework
Talk by Igor in track 1 Silex - The Symfony2 microframework |
An introduction to Phing the PHP build system
Talk by Jeremy Coates in track 2 An introduction to Phing the PHP build system |
|
CLI, the other SAPI
Talk by Thijs Feryn in track 3 CLI, the other SAPI |
|
15:30 |
Dependency Management with Composer
Talk by Jordi Boggiano in track 1 Dependency Management with Composer |
Designing HTTP Interfaces and RESTful Web Services
Talk by David Zuelke in track 2 Designing HTTP Interfaces and RESTful Web Services |
|
Deploying PHP web applications on Windows Azure
Talk by Alessandro Pilotti, Pietro Brambati in track 3 Deploying PHP web applications on Windows Azure |
|
16:30 |
eXtreme Automation
Talk by Michele Orselli in track 1 eXtreme Automation |
Building a self-sufficient team
Talk by Filippo De Santis in track 2 Building a self-sufficient team |
|
Getting Started with Static Analysis using HipHop for PHP
Talk by Nick Galbreath in track 3 Getting Started with Static Analysis using HipHop for PHP |
|
17:30 |
Taking it to the next level
Keynote by David Coallier Taking it to the next level |